Coming off the success of our Titanium Strut Tower Bars - we wanted to explore a few more titanium goods. There are a couple projects already underway - but for a high dollar item like this - I wanted to check in with everyone first.
High on my personal list of "wants" is a Titanium Dolphin Tail Exhaust. The RE-A one is obviously top of the list, but seeing as they don't make it anymore AND used ones in pretty rough condition can fetch $1500+ I was thinking about getting tooled up for a run.
The plan would be to run a small batch again (we'll see where the interest ends up) with a target price of $1500. Pre-order would be 50/50 - half down to commit and secure a spot, the other half due at shipping. It seemed to work out pretty well for people last time, so why not try it again?
The goal would be to pay homage to this legendary exhaust and improve upon it where we can.
FEATURES
- Full titanium from flange to tip
- Low profile oval muffler
- Quality packing for proper noise deadening
- 3in (80mm) piping
- Optional 3.5in (90mm) piping MIGHT be possible
- Single 4in (100mm) 'Dolphin Tail' tip
- Optional dual 2in (60mm) 'Dolphin Tail' tips
- Choice of fully polished or matte finish muffler/tip - both would have a burnt end
- Weight TBD - but expect under 10lbs

TA Dolphin titanium muffler
It's the fifth item on the list.
It was discontinued until Ito-San of Ito Syokai hounded Ama-San to bring it back specifically for his personal car. FYI, It's now become an RE Amemiya x Ito Syokai collaboration item that is sold under Ito Syokai and as far as I know, it is still available. Just tossing this out there since you had mentioned that it is no longer available.
